Justin Townes Earle, Henry Wagons Lead New Americana Festival

Say hello to Out On The Weekend.

A new festival will debut on the local calendar this year in Victoria, with Out On The Weekend providing punters with a day of quality Americana music.

Leading the bill will be US muso Justin Townes Earle, who announced his latest album yesterday, as well as charismatic local Henry Wagons. Country, bluegrass and folk blender Robert Ellis, Los Angeles muso Ryan Bingham and Canadian singer-songwriter Lindi Ortega are among the other names confirmed for the event.

Justin Townes Earle, Henry Wagons, Ryan Bingham, Robert Ellis, Lindi Ortega, Nikki Lane, The Delines, Johnny Fritz, Emma Swift, Chris Altmann, Raised By Eagles, The Morrisons

Out On The Weekend will also provide a quality menu of gourmet food and beverages for punters, with Porteno/Bodega chefs Ben Milgate and Elvis Abrahanowicz and Melbourne's Raph Rashid behind some of what will be consumed on the day.

The festival will take place on the water at Seaworks, Williamstown between 11:30am to 10:30pm on Saturday 18 October. Tickets go on sale next Friday 25 July, with free entry for kids under the age of 12. For more info, check out theGuide or The Music App.
